Homemade snow plow for Kubota B2601. I've been wanting a snow plow but am too cheap to buy a new one so I decided to convert an old truck plow to fit my compact tractor. Snow came the night I got it done so I was able to test it out right away. Based on limited use my DIY snowplow should fit my needs perfectly.

I have built 2 plow setups for my tractor. First was a solid weld to the back plate and the second after learning alot of the faults with that was a setup like yours. Solid mount is simple and has great down pressure. The problem is your blade is on the same plane as the rear tires so unless you have a real flat driveway and have your blade at the perfect level so the bottom stays flat to the ground when you pivot it, the corners are always digging in. I have a 40 horse New Holland and it really had it's way with that old plow and it slowly destroyed it by making it flex to the ground. 900' feet of dirt driveway doesn't help either. I like the pipe over the chain idea another person mentioned might be best of both worlds. It also would probably help when you are attaching the plow to keep the plate upright when you're trying to hook in. That's always a problem if I don't unhook in just the right spot. Can't push it around like a bucket. One other lesson I learned no weight on the 3 point. It pivots on the rear tires and makes the front tires lighter so it won't steer.. I know you mentioned that in your other video. I had the same issue on hills and with a heavy full blade until I removed my weight. I do have loaded rear tires though not sure if you do. Nice rebuild. I did the exact same thing for mine. Rebuilt an old Meyer 8' truck blade for my JD 5075E. Actual tractor plows have much shorter a-frames and usually use 1 cross-wise cylinder to keep the blade closer to the tractor. Gravel is hard to plow, especially with soft and unfrozen base. Had about $800 in mine which is about a third of what a manufactured one for a tractor would cost. I'm having trouble with my Titan plate as it's only 1/4" thick and is gets torn apart by the 11,000 lb tractor and 8' blade. The A-frame is actually getting pushed through the steel. So I bought some 1/2" plate and a set of JD quick-attach brackets and have to swap the whole back plate assembly out to something much stronger. I think I ended up around $550. $250 for the plow, $170 for the cylinders hoses and fittings, $125 for the adaptor plate plus some steel. The cylinders were a big unplanned expense. If you wait til spring I bet you can find a beater plow with functioning cylinders and get it done for less than I spent.
